Today I came home from work to use my notebook computer (Toshiba Satellite M40-JM8), and found that my battery monitor widget was not displaying any information. I check the taskbar icon, and that was displaying nothing either. So I go into power management properties, and it states that the batter is "critical".

When I have the power plugged into the unit, it did the same thing. However, when I have it unplugged, the power indicator light flashes orange. Here's a screen shot of what's showing up on my screen:



I'm not too sure what to make of this, so I figured I'd ask the computer wizzes here first. I'm off to Toshiba help to find out what's wrong.
